
The 2012 End-2-End mountain bike race has reached full capacity within a week of registration opening.
The sheer volume of cyclists wanting to compete in the 46-mile challenge saw organisers increase the event's capacity to 1,700 last year.
Organiser Steve Honeybone said: ‘The level of interest is amazing but we have to cap it for the riders' safety.’
More than 650 riders will travel to the Island to compete in the race in September.
